If ` vec a\ a n d\ vec b` are two vectors of the same magnitude inclined at angle of `30^0` such that ` vec a dot vec b=3`,
find` | vec a|,| vec b|dot`

Given that,
` vec a\ a n d\ vec b` are two vectors of the same magnitude inclined at angle of `30^0`
so,`|vec a|=|vec b|`
we have ,
` vec a * vec b=3`
we know that,
` vec a * vec b=|vec a||vec b| cos theta`
`=>3=|vec a|^2 cos 30^o`
`=>3/cos 30^o=|vec a|^2`
`=>|vec a|^2=2sqrt3`
`=>|vec a|=sqrt(2sqrt3)`
so,`|vec a|=|vec b|=sqrt(2sqrt3)`
